About Brian P. Dolan

Brian P. Dolan is a scholar working on Nuclear and High Energy Physics, Statistical and Nonlinear Physics, Astronomy and Astrophysics, Condensed Matter Physics and Mathematical Physics, having authored 78 papers that have together received 2.3k indexed citations. Recurring topics across this work include Black Holes and Theoretical Physics (40 papers), Cosmology and Gravitation Theories (28 papers), Noncommutative and Quantum Gravity Theories (26 papers), Quantum and electron transport phenomena (13 papers), Physics of Superconductivity and Magnetism (9 papers), Particle physics theoretical and experimental studies (8 papers), Quantum Chromodynamics and Particle Interactions (8 papers) and Theoretical and Computational Physics (6 papers). The work is most often cited by research in Nuclear and High Energy Physics (1.9k citations), Astronomy and Astrophysics (1.7k citations), Statistical and Nonlinear Physics (1.0k citations), Atomic and Molecular Physics, and Optics (458 citations) and Geometry and Topology (112 citations). Brian P. Dolan has collaborated with scholars based in Ireland, United Kingdom and United States. Frequent co-authors include C. P. Burgess, Denjoe O’Connor, David Kubizňák, Robert B. Mann, Jennie Traschen, David Kastor, P. Prešnajder, A. P. Balachandran, Richard J. Szabo and Xavier Martín. Their work appears in journals such as Physics Letters B, Journal of High Energy Physics, Classical and Quantum Gravity, International Journal of Modern Physics A and Physical review. B, Condensed matter.
